Interestingly both had a relationship to a NLS in there lives.
For Andrew, it was Non-Linear Systems, where Andrew invented the digital voltmeter.
For Alan, it was oN-Line System, where he attended "The Mother of All Demos", which spawned the mouse and some other inventions used in the Xerox Alto, which is where Smalltalk was primarily developed initially.
